Alpha ˈælfə ⓘ ALF-ə[1] (uppercase Α, lowercase α) [a] is the first letter of the Greek alphabet In the system of Greek numerals, it has a value of one

The ‘α’ is a letter of the Greek alphabet In mathematics, physics, and engineering, it is often used to denote an angle, a coefficient of thermal expansion, as an alpha particle, among other uses

The alpha symbol (α) is a mathematical symbol representing the first letter of the Greek alphabet Mathematics, science, and engineering frequently denote various concepts, such as angles in geometry and trigonometry, coefficients in algebraic expressions, alpha particles in physics, and alpha waves in neuroscience

The letter represented the open front unrounded vowel: a , aː Today, this letter is often represented by lower case α (a), although Ancient Greek did not distinguish between upper and lower case
